Let me summarize:
I updgraded from April release to today's, no Pb, but when I rebooted on
kernel 2.6.15-23-386 , I got the same sync Pb as the one from a new
install from today's version i.e.:
[4294712.245000] <0> kernel panic - not syncing: fatal exception in
interrupt.
It's more clear now (maybe for Phil who answered to me one hour ago). It
has nothing to do w/ an eventual bad grub initialization because I just
upgraded the existing.
I then rebooted from my previous saved kernel (2.6.15-20-386) and it
WORKED FINE as before
My PC is a laptop Toshiba M70-168
Processor: Intel M40 1.7 GHz
HD: sata 80 GB
Ram: 512
